wymberley Posted July 11, 2013 Report Share Posted July 11, 2013 Have just played with some of these but did not shoot any quarry. They were very accurate but before I got any further I had an offer for the rifle I'd used them in which I accepted. They don't compete (not criticism, just fact) with those that I use in the other rifle so progress ceased at that point. However, perusal of he Sierra Bullets website reflects that they, themselves, state that at Hornet velocities these are, "hard" so they may not meet your requirements. I infer from their description that whereas they're described as an explosive varminter bullet, they need some poke to realise that potential. I use the Sierra Infinity Suite ballistic tables and the ballistic table for the bullet itself it throws up 3400 as a starting point, but the reloading guide using Lil'Gun gives a max of 2800ft/sec. I would suggest that 3000 is possible, but is that sufficiently higher than the 2800 and not too much below the 3400 to achieve your objective? alendil Posted July 11, 2013 Report Share Posted July 11, 2013 I believe that Alendil is using the serria 45 grain hornet to great affect. Yes i do. over 12.8 grain o lilgun powder and it is explosive on rabits. some rabits headshoted(about 120-150 yards) and skined show some copper jacket fragments but generaly i didnt notice any problem with shalow angle on the ground. i think they are just spot on in my rifle and will stick with them. Btw copper jacket looks to be quite thin on thise bullets. that is the bulet i use. 45 grain sp no.1210 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
